Michael Brown, D.O., is a highly skilled musculoskeletal radiologist with extensive experience in advanced MSK imaging, academic leadership, and clinical education. Prior to joining Radsource, he served as Lead Musculoskeletal Radiologist at Santa Ana–Tustin Radiology Group in Orange County, where he was a full partner and vice president of the executive board. In this role, Dr. Brown has been deeply involved in clinical operations, physician leadership, and subspecialty imaging excellence.
Dr. Brown completed advanced musculoskeletal radiology training at the University of California, San Francisco. He completed his diagnostic radiology residency at the Cleveland Clinic, where he was their first resident to complete the American Board of Radiology’s integrated Nuclear Medicine fellowship pathway. His training also includes a transitional year internship at John T. Mather Memorial Hospital/Stony Brook and a Doctor of Osteopathic Medicine degree from NYIT College of Osteopathic Medicine. He earned dual undergraduate degrees in Neuroscience and Film and Media Studies from the University of Rochester.
A dedicated educator and leader, Dr. Brown served as Education Chief and Senior Chief Resident during residency and received multiple teaching awards from residents and medical students. He has held faculty teaching appointments, participated in national radiology leadership programs, contributed to academic research and presented educational exhibits at national meetings.
